Bug#783498: cmus: Segmentation fault adding FLAC files to a clean empty database

mathew meta at pobox.com
Mon Apr 27 14:36:25 UTC 2015


Package: cmus
Version: 2.5.0-7+b1
Severity: important

So having eliminated my DECnet problems, I set about adding my library
of music which had worked fine in Debian 7's latest version of cmus. 

I removed ~/.cmus, started cmus, and told it to import my music.

Unfortunately, while adding FLAC files cmus has a segmentation fault and
crashes. No other debug information is shown in console or found in the logs.

Please let me know if there's anything I can do to help track down the
cause.
